Output 93066e5954b3ab8f4e2311a560fded37e68b2c88212b5deeb0388b02deeddf77: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b520f4a59136619a76fc1fda84904a81a3f26e OP_EQUALVERIFY OP_CHECKSIG
address
1MfihQ89KrANYZNARfbXYfedWZ2QfLJkYH
transaction
93066e5954b3ab8f4e2311a560fded37e68b2c88212b5deeb0388b02deeddf77
spent
true